About the Cost of Living in Ennis
The median home value in Ennis is $225,900 — 26% below the national median of $305,000. Median rent runs $1,233/month, 6% lower than the national median of $1,314/month. The median household income of $72,772/year is 2% lower than the US median of $74,580. The local unemployment rate is 3.0%, below the national average of 4.8%. Texas charges no state income tax, a meaningful advantage for take-home pay. The climate averages highs of 77.6°F and lows of 56.3°F. Overall, Ennis has a cost of living index of 82 versus the US average of 100, meaning it is 18% less expensive.

🌤 Climate
NOAA 1991–2020 Climate Normals
| Month | Jan | Feb | Mar | Apr | May | Jun | Jul | Aug | Sep | Oct | Nov | Dec |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| High °F | 59 | 63 | 70 | 77 | 84 | 91 | 95 | 96 | 90 | 80 | 68 | 60 |
| Low °F | 38 | 41 | 48 | 55 | 64 | 71 | 74 | 74 | 68 | 57 | 47 | 39 |
| Precip" | 2.76 | 2.67 | 3.58 | 3.48 | 4.42 | 3.82 | 2.28 | 2.28 | 2.53 | 5.10 | 3.18 | 3.23 |
